Transaction 5bd7a918ba6220bc03ea22ecd478a796380a41fc32e4e31892eec57164adeed1
1 Input
1 Output
-
5bd7a918ba6220bc03ea22ecd478a796380a41fc32e4e31892eec57164adeed1:0
- value
- 3440940
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c35ea10f8e389579c6574dfd9579e3778c169ac OP_EQUAL
- address
- 3QganvBZKAbb8142HQAWmfqBhJa9y2VmQm